Guests of Honor<br />
Jason Carter (Autographs- Saturday, 2:00 pm - 3:30 pm, Greenway Room)<br />
Perhaps best remembered for his portrayal of Marcus Cole in ‘Babylon 5’, Jason began his career<br />
in London.<br />
In 1981, after a three-month tour of Holland and Belgium playing Romeo in “Romeo and Juliet”<br />
he graduated The London Academy of Music and Dramatic Art. Much British theatre followed with<br />
plays throughout Britain including playing Macbeth at Chichester Festival Theatre. Long runs in<br />
the London West End: “The Sleeping prince” with Omar Sharrif; Simon Gray’s “Melon” with Alan<br />
Bates and Simon Gray’s “The Common Pursuit”.<br />
At the Royal National Theatre he played Naraboth in Steven Berkoff’s innovative production of Oscar Wilde’s “Salome”.<br />
Since he landed in America Jason had roles in many TV productions including “Viper”, “Beverly Hills 90210”, “Roar”, “3rd<br />
Rock from the Sun”, “Charmed”, “Lois and Clarke” and “Angel”. Film work includes “Georgia”, “The Mesmerist”, “Wild Obsession”,<br />
“Dakota Road”, “The Emperor’s New Clothes” and “King David”. Recently, Jason acted with Woody Harellson and<br />
Liam Hemsworth in their yet to be released movie “By Way of Helena.”<br />
Enrica Jang<br />
Enrica Jang is the writer and creator of Azteca, Angel With a Bullet, The Star Thief, The House of<br />
Montresor, and editor of the annual Red Stylo Presents series of anthologies. Her screenplay The<br />
Freshmen was made into a short film, Frienemies, winner of a CINE Golden Eagle in 2011. Read<br />
more about her at enricajang.com.<br />
Jerry Jewell (Autographs- Saturday, 2:00 pm - 3:30 pm, Greenway Room)<br />
With over 150 credits to his name, Jerry Jewell can be heard in a wide variety of shows. He’s probably<br />
best known for his roles as Kyo Sohma in Fruits Basket, Jimmy Kudo in Case Closed, Barry the<br />
Chopper/Number 66 in Fullmetal Alchemist, Fullmetal Alchemist: Brotherhood, Claire Stanfield<br />
in Baccano!, Russia in Hetalia: Axis Powers, and Lau in Black Butler. Recent roles include Aion in<br />
Show By Rock!!, Momotaro Mikoshiba in Free! Eternal Summer and Yuma Isogai in Assassination<br />
Classroom. Other popular roles include Lyon in Fairy Tail, Taira in Beck: Mongolian Chop Squad,<br />
Kaworu Nagisa in the Evangelion movies: 1.0, 2.0 and 3.0, Happiness Bunny in Shin-Chan, Rin Tsuchimi<br />
in Shuffle, Zelman Clock in Black Blood Brothers, Dio in Casshern Sins, Suzaku and Jin in Yu<br />
Yu Hakusho, and Akito Hayama in Kodocha.<br />
Having worked as a voice actor for FUNimation since 2001, Jerry has taken on a different role at FUNimation, that of ADR<br />
Director. His first show was Blood C, followed by Shakugan no Shana III, Toriko, We Without Wings, Senran Kagura, Kamisama<br />
Kiss, A Certain Scientific Railgun S, episodes 313 – 324 of One Piece and Is This a Zombie?, Free! Eternal Summer<br />
and most recently Seraph of the End. Jerry is very honored to have had the opportunity to work with a very talented and<br />
dedicated group of people at FUNimation, who take the quality of what they do very seriously. Well...seriously enough.<br />
(Autographs- Saturday, 2:00 pm - 3:30 pm, Greenway Room) Christina Kelly<br />
Christina Marie Kelly is an American actress and voice actress for Sentai Filmworks. Kelly attended<br />
the University of Houston’s School of Theatre and Dance where she received her Bachelor of Fine<br />
Arts Degree in Acting. While there Kelly worked on shows such as The Miser, Blood Wedding, and<br />
Zombie Prom- The Musical. In Houston she’s appeared on stage at Unity Theatre and The Catastrophic<br />
Theatre. Her roles in anime include Ersha in Cross Ange: Rondo of Angel and Dragon,<br />
Satone Shichimiya in Love Chunibyo and Other Delusions- Heart Throb, Hajime in Hamatora, Kisara<br />
Tendo in Black Bullet and Mine in Akame Ga Kill which was featured on Adult Swim’s Toonami.<br />
Other credits include No Game, No Life, Brynhildr in the Darkness, Nobunaga the Fool, Monthly<br />
Girls’ Nozaki- Kun, and Log Horizon.<br />
